Output 514fae7b60382ac73ce773bb32a64c585209d2bc456cdfd97d5a0edcb588b62c:1

value
3582712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0234cd6a33ff98d8cb99d572fa88dc5e1e3ba651 OP_EQUAL
address
31tgXhhpyaWBoHJtvZRmzJwjoafamiDPJB
transaction
514fae7b60382ac73ce773bb32a64c585209d2bc456cdfd97d5a0edcb588b62c
confirmations
280575
spent
true